With wonders like the
Capilano
Suspension Bridge, the world’s highest and longest
suspension footbridge, 230 feet high and 450 feet long,
Vancouver is a sight to be seen. Blade, bike or stroll the 8.8
km seawall surrounding the rolling, lush 1,000 acres of
Stanley Park. Bask in the sun at Kitsilano Beach or sip a
martini in trendy Yaletown. Raise a toast to wine, food and
theatre at the Vancouver Playhouse International Wine Festival.
Or learn new moves from the international choreographers at the
Dancing on the Edge Festival.
